5. Xinjiang River

Potential Use of Drone: Yunetec Typhoon H Plus How to Purchase: Amazon Price: $1,349.99* @HelloRF Zcool is a social media user that took this picture. The Xinjiang River is shown in this overhead view, and the colours are remarkable. Although the exact drone used is unknown, it may have been the Yuneec Typhoon H Plus, a hexacopter capable of taking 20MP 360-degree photos. Triple-axis, sensor-driven picture stabilisation technology is used in the H Plus. River Xinjiang ©HelloRF Shutterstock/Zcool The Xinjiang River is 175 miles long, and its drainage basin covers 5,0000 square miles in Kyrgyzstan. It is also known as the Aksu River, which means "White/Clear Water" in Kyrgyz and Uyghur.

6. Field of Yellow

Potential Use of Drone: DJI Mavic Mini Purchase Location: Best Buy Price: $599.98* Looking at this aerial view, you probably wouldn't know what you were seeing if you weren't looking very closely. The image shows a field of yellow rapeseed in bloom. The Brassica subspecies is cultivated because of its high erucic acid content and is recognised for its bright yellow colour. Canola oil, which is used in almost everything, is essentially made from rapeseed.

Shutterstock / Smit / Yellow Field In Ukraine, social media user @Smit captured this image. Tractor tracks are the source of the lines, and the light intensifies the colours. The handy and well-liked DJI Mavic Mini drone by travellers might have been the one utilised for this picture.
